HL Deb 02 December 2004 vol 667 cc13-4WA
Viscount Simon

asked Her Majesty's Government:

What progress has been made towards fulfilling the European Commission Recommendation on Enforcement in the Field of Road Safety (2004/245/EC). [HL82]

Lord Davies of Oldham

The recommendation was adopted by the European Commission on 21 October 2003. Since then the UK has participated in an expert group on enforcement in June this year and a meeting of a sub-group on seat belts. Further sub-group meetings on speeding and drink-driving are planned. The aim of these groups is to identify common ground, encourage collaboration between member states and to establish good practice in road traffic enforcement.

Road traffic enforcement was discussed recently at an informal meeting of EU road safety Ministers in Verona (October 2004), which was attended by the Minister for Road Safety (David Jamieson). The meeting underlined the importance of enforcement for road safety and the conclusions are due to be considered at a forthcoming meeting of the Transport Council.
